Solution Overview

Problem

Casinos face challenges in maximizing the use of limited casino floor space due to the standard size of gaming machines, which often requires removing existing machines to make room for new ones, and the need to accommodate highly popular games by increasing their numbers.

Innovation Solution

The configuration of gaming machines with reduced widths, such as 50% of standard widths, and trapezoidal horizontal cross-sectional shapes, allows for increased density by enabling more machines to be placed in a given space, including arrangements where machines face opposite directions or are arranged in circular banks.

Solution Approach 1:

The patent applies parameter changes by reducing the width parameter of the gaming machine cabinet from the standard 28 inches to approximately 14 inches (50% reduction), while maintaining the display size and operational functionality. This parameter change enables doubling or tripling the number of machines per floor space unit.

Solution Approach 2:

The patent utilizes vertical dimension by mounting displays on the cabinet doors rather than on the top box, and by arranging machines in circular banks or alternating facing directions. This dimensional reorganization maximizes space utilization without compromising player accessibility.

AI summary

Gaming machines, housings or cabinets for gaming machines, and arrangements of gaming machines are configured to minimize the amount of casino floor space occupied thereby. Gaming machines are configured so that, when located adjacent to one another, an increased number of gaming machines can be located in a designated amount of casino floor space, such as where a width of the gaming machine is reduced, or where a width of a housing of the gaming machine is reduced in relation to a video display thereof, and/or where the gaming machine has a generally trapezoidal cross-sectional shape which allows gaming machines to be arranged in overlapping reverse configuration.
